After all modules have been reinstalled, parameter 95.13 Reduced run mode must be
reset to 0 to disable the reduced run function. In case the inverter is equipped with a
charging circuit, the charging monitoring must be reactivated for all modules. If the
Safe torque off (STO) function is in use, an acceptance test must be performed (see
the hardware manual of the drive/inverter unit for instructions).

du/dt filter support
With an external du/dt filter connected to the output of the drive, bit 13 of 95.20 HW
options word 1 must be switched on. The setting limits the output switching
frequency, and forces the drive/inverter module fan to full speed. Note that the setting
is not to be activated with inverter modules with internal du/dt filters.
Settings
Parameter 95.20 HW options word 1 (page 477).
Sine filter support
The control program has a setting that enables the use of sine filters (available
separately from ABB and others).
With an ABB sine filter connected to the output of the drive, bit 1 of 95.15 Special HW
settings must be switched on. The setting limits the switching and output frequencies
to
prevent the drive from operating at filter resonance frequencies, and
protect the filter from overheating.
With a custom sine filter, bit 3 of 95.15 Special HW settings must be switched on.
(The setting does not limit the output frequency.) Additional parameters must be set
according to the properties of the filter as listed below.
Settings
For both ABB and custom filters: Parameter 95.15 Special HW settings (page 476).
